## Velta Schema Registry — quick ops notes

Welcome aboard! The Velta registry stores every event schema our pipelines consume. If a producer starts failing validation, check whether someone published a breaking version — the registry keeps full history, so you can diff versions from the CLI. Rollbacks are one command, but always ping the owning team first. The CLI talks to the registry's internal admin API, so you'll need a credential. Use the admin key below.

gateway credential: kto3_qfe

## Changelog — DeployCrier bot v2.4

- Renamed setting: CRIER_HOOK is now CRIER_DEPLOY_HOOK. Old name removed, no fallback.
- Status messages now include rollback markers.
- Dropped support for the legacy Fennelport relay.

Release manager action: update every env file before cutting the release; the bot refuses to start if the old name is present. After the renamed setting, the bot still needs its posting credential, which goes on the following line:

secret setting of yajog-taguf: ARCHIVE_KEY3=051

Handover note — Crumbwheel order cutoffs.

Welcome aboard. The bakery cutoff rule in Crumbwheel closes same-day orders at 14:00 local to each storefront, not UTC — this has bitten us twice. Holiday overrides live in the calendar service and take precedence silently, so always check there first when a cutoff looks wrong. To unlock the calendar service's admin console after a restart, enter the recovery passphrase below.

vault phrase of bagap-bahaf = silion-pelox-sorox-casdor-quenwyn-fraax-eliox-praael-kelion-quenvan-kasox-rusael-norius-belvan